The draft London Plan introduces clearer energy targets, but does it provide a consistent basis for decision-making?

If we are serious about decarbonising real estate, planning policies that prioritise reducing energy and carbon should be welcome. The new draft London Plan reflects the direction the industry has already been moving in, largely through setting energy intensity limits for new and major refurbishment projects.
Rather than assessing performance solely through a percentage improvement over Building Regulations Part L baseline values, as the current London Plan does, absolute targets should make as-designed performance easier to understand, compare and communicate. For example, a building either achieves an EUI of 70 kWh/m² per year, or it does not.
This however, raises a familiar question: How should the draft London Plan’s figures be interpreted alongside net zero carbon reduction pathways already being used by the industry?
The proposed London Plan targets
The draft plan proposes baseline and aspirational EUI targets for several major development types across both regulated energy (energy used for the building operations, e.g., HVAC systems) and unregulated energy (energy used by the occupier).
The move to absolute energy targets is more closely aligned with the direction of travel established by frameworks such as Carbon Risk Real Estate Monitor (CRREM) and the UK Net Zero Carbon Buildings Standard (UKNZCBS). However, once the different figures are placed side-by-side, the picture becomes less straightforward.
A plan to 2050
The Greater London Authority (GLA) describes the draft plan as looking ahead to 2050 and therefore to ensure buildings built or refurbished today are net zero aligned, but are they future-proofed through to 2050? Consider an office achieving the London Plan baseline target of 90 kWh/m² per year, which would outperform the CRREM pathway in 2030. It would, however, then exceed the CRREM limit from 2040 and would not meet the UKNZCBS pathway at any of the three comparison years.
These inconsistencies are not limited to offices. Based on the current comparison, multi-family residential is the only development type for which both London Plan targets stay under the applicable CRREM and UKNZCBS pathways through to 2050. Part of the apparent inconsistency arises because the frameworks have different purposes. The London Plan is a planning policy. Its baseline values need to establish a practical minimum standard that can be applied across major developments of varying challenges.
On the other hand, CRREM is primarily a transition-risk pathway. It helps owners understand whether an asset’s energy or carbon intensity is likely to remain aligned with a country’s top-down decarbonisation trajectory over time. The UKNZCBS is intended to establish whether a building can credibly be described as net zero carbon aligned. Its requirements extend beyond a single EUI value and include matters such as embodied carbon, refrigerants and renewable energy.
Best practice approach
For a development, the clearest assessment is therefore not a single comparison. Each assessment should state:
Planning compliance: Does the development meet the London Plan baseline?
Best-practice design: Does it meet the London Plan aspirational target?
Transition alignment: How does it compare with CRREM in 2030, 2040 and 2050?
Net zero alignment: How does it compare with the applicable UKNZCBS pathway and wider standard requirements?
Energy resilience: How effectively does the development generate, store, manage and use renewable energy on-site after demand has been minimised?
This would allow clients to understand why the figures differ, rather than being left to decide which number is ‘right’.
The draft London Plan’s move towards absolute operational energy targets should be welcomed. It creates a clearer basis for discussing how much energy a building should use and strengthens the link between planning-stage design and real operational performance. But it also demonstrates that introducing clearer targets does not, by itself, create a consistent basis for decision-making or actual in-use net zero aligned buildings.
